Mike Gesicki led all scorers with 32 points as Southern Regional High School defeated Long Branch 56-50 in a Shore Conference boys basketball game Saturday.
Gesicki, a senior, was 10-for-13 from the foul line. The Rams jumped to a 23-5 first-quarter lead but the game was tied 43-43 entering the fourth quarter.
For Long Branch, Terrell Cox scored 16 points.
